JSP(Java Server Pages)是一种在Java EE中非常流行的技术。JSP使得Web应用程序的开发变得更加快速,可靠且容易维护。在JSP中,注释是一种非常重要的特性,因为它们可以帮助我们在代码中添加一些有用的说明,而不影响应用程序的功能。在本文中,我们将探讨如何在JSP中正确使用注释,并掌握在应用程序开发中充分利用它们的技巧。
1. JSP中的注释类型
JSP中有三种不同类型的注释,这些注释类型根据注释的风格和注释的作用可以分为以下三种类型:
- HTML注释
- JSP注释
- Java注释
下面我们分别来看这三种注释的特点。
1.1 HTML 注释
HTML注释包括在 之间的内容。HTML注释只是提示性的,不能包含任何JSP或Java代码。HTML注释的作用是给阅读源代码的其他开发者提供一些信息。
以下是一个HTML注释的例子:
```
```
1.2 JSP 注释
JSP注释包括在<%-- 和 --%> 之间的内容。JSP注释可以包含JSP或Java代码,但不会被编译或发送到客户端。JSP注释的作用是向其他开发者或自己添加一些注释,以帮助理解JSP代码的目的和功能。
以下是一个JSP注释的例子:
```
<%-- 这是一个JSP注释,包含JSP代码 --%>
```
1.3 Java 注释
Java注释包括在/* 和 */ 之间的内容,或者以// 开头直到该行结束。Java注释可以包含任何Java代码,但不会被编译或发送到客户端。Java注释的作用是向其他开发者或自己添加一些注释,以帮助理解Java代码的目的和功能。
以下是一个Java注释的例子:
```
/*
这是一个Java注释,包含Java代码
*/
```
2. JSP 中注释的使用
在JSP中,注释可以帮助开发者更好地理解JSP代码的目的和功能。注释也可以帮助开发者更好地协作,特别是在多人开发项目的情况下。下面我们将从以下几个方面介绍如何正确使用JSP注释。
2.1 给JSP代码添加注释
在JSP中添加注释是非常简单的。只需要在JSP代码中添加<%-- 和 --%>之间的内容即可。以下是一个简单的例子:
```
<%-- 这是一个JSP注释 --%>
<%-- 这是一个JSP注释 --%>
<% out.print("Hello World!"); %>
```
上面的代码演示了如何在JSP代码中添加注释。在这个例子中,我们用JSP注释包含了两个不同的注释,来说明JSP代码的作用。
2.2 注释代码块
在JSP中,注释还可以用来注释一段代码块。如果你想将一段代码块注释掉,在该块前后添加 <%-- 和 --%> 之间的注释即可。下面是一个注释代码块的例子:
```
<%--
<%
// 这是一段你不想执行的 JSP 代码
%>
--%>
```
在上面的代码中,我们注释掉了JSP代码块中的JSP代码,使得这些代码不会被执行。
2.3 使用注释分开多个JSP 片段
如果你在JSP文件中嵌套了多个JSP片段,那么注释可以帮助你更好地分开这些片段。下面是一个JSP文件的例子,其中嵌套了两个JSP代码片段,并使用了注释来分开它们:
```
<%-- 第一个 JSP 代码片段 --%>
<%
for (int i=0; i<10; i++) {
out.print(i + "
");
}
%>
<%-- 分割线 --%>
<%-- 第二个 JSP 代码片段 --%>
<%
for (int i=10; i<20; i++) {
out.print(i + "
");
}
%>
```
在上面的代码中,我们将两个JSP代码片段用注释分开了,这使得代码更可读。
3. 总结
在JSP应用程序开发中,注释是一个非常重要的特性。注释可以帮助开发者更好地理解和维护代码,同时还可以提高多人协作的效率。在本文中,我们介绍了JSP中三种不同类型的注释(HTML、JSP 和 Java),以及如何在JSP中正确使用它们来添加注释、注释代码块和分开多个JSP片段。通过这些技巧,你可以更好地利用注释来开发高质量、易于维护的JSP应用程序。